Technical Services Specialist
EMS Management & Consultants, Inc. is seeking a Technical Solutions Specialist responsible for supporting the design, configuration, and delivery of technical solutions for revenue cycle operations. The role involves collaborating with various teams to ensure technology meets customer-specific requirements and includes responsibilities such as requirement gathering, testing, and providing training.

Responsibilities
Support the design, configuration, and delivery of reports, dashboards, and data solutions needed to meet internal and client needs
Partner with stakeholders to gather business requirements, document workflows, and translate needs into clear technical specifications
Partner with Sales and Client Success teams to onboard new customers throughout the sales cycle, including proposal review, customer onboarding meetings, and technical requirements gathering
Perform testing and quality assurance for new reports, data extracts, and system enhancements to ensure accuracy and reliability
Serve as a subject matter expert (SME) for data requirements related to customer data Accounts Receivable (AR) conversions
Troubleshoot issues related to reporting, data integrity, and system integrations, escalating as needed to technical teams
Serve as a subject matter resource on EMS|MC’s data structures, reporting tools, and revenue cycle workflows
Help develop and maintain documentation for data definitions and solution requirements
Provide training and education to internal users on customer-specific solutions and data usage best practices
Identify opportunities to improve processes, create standardization, and promote automation
Ensure all data handling complies with privacy, security, and regulatory requirements, including HIPAA

Qualification
Required
Bachelor's degree in Information Systems, Business Analytics, Computer Science, Healthcare Administration, a related field or equivalent experience
2+ years of experience in a technical, reporting, analytics, or solutions-focused role
Detailed knowledge of EMS revenue cycle processes, data structures, and existing technical solutions
Proficiency with Structured Query Language (SQL) and working knowledge of relational databases
Strong analytical and problem-solving skills with the ability to work through complex data questions
Ability to communicate effectively with both technical and non-technical stakeholders
Strong organizational skills and experience managing multiple tasks or projects simultaneously
Proficiency in English is necessary for job-related communication, including understanding policies, writing correspondence, and engaging with colleagues or clients
Preferred
Experience in healthcare technology, EMS/ambulance billing, or revenue cycle management
Knowledge of HL7, NEMSIS, X12, or other healthcare data standards
Experience with cloud platforms (AWS preferred)
Background in scripting languages (Python, PowerShell, or similar)
Experience with supporting client implementations or technical pre-sales activities

EMS Management & Consultants, Inc.
EMS|MC is the largest billing services provider focused exclusively on emergency medical services in the United States.
